protocercal

English

Etymology

proto- +? cercal

Adjective

protocercal (not comparable)

  1. (zoology) Having a caudal fin extending around the end of the vertebral column, like that which is first formed in the embryo of fishes; diphycercal.

homocercal

English

Etymology

homo- +? cercal

Adjective

homocercal

  1. (ichthyology) Describing the symmetric tail of a fish that has two lobes extending from the end of the vertebral column.

Coordinate terms

  • diphycercal
  • heterocercal
  • protocercal
